Output 8a95337b031f6eca41c1e0e43de75e44bbb40731e588ec58bbbe5d5b43ca736c:0

value
280400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1c8633faeeaf21d742c366ae4ae2cf5e2b9a7f OP_EQUAL
address
3Jqf8WJzFfspZrbJmhMY16nbnC2uh787E9
transaction
8a95337b031f6eca41c1e0e43de75e44bbb40731e588ec58bbbe5d5b43ca736c
confirmations
170582
spent
true